Oiles 2000 Sintered multi-layer bearings with dispersed solid lubricant

 

 

Feature
● Dispersed solid lubricant allows motions in any direction and offers superior
performance for minute movements.
● Serviceable without the need for lubrication.
● Features superior load resistance, speed characteristics, and wear resistance.
● Standard products and plates for additional machining are available in various
sizes.
 

Bearings with superior wear resistance that may be used in any direction

The Oiles 2000 series are composite multi-layer bearings composed of sliding surfaces made of special sintered material and steel back metals. Solid lubricant mainly made of graphite is dispersed in the sintered layer, which is sintered and impregnated with oil.

The process of powder metallurgy has (3) basic steps:
 

  1. First, the metal, in this case, bronze or bronze alloy, is made into a powdered form. This can be achieved by a number of methods including grinding, chemical decomposition and the most common atomization.
  2. The metallic powder is then poured into a die or mold cavity and compacted under great pressure in order to adhere the particles. This occurs at room temperature.
  3. The metal part is then inserted into a furnace where the extreme heat fuses the metal particles together to form a rigid, high strength and porous component. This part of the process is called sintering.

The resulting porosity of the sintered parts makes powder metal products especially useful in lubricating applications and as a result, bearings and wear plates are often fabricated from sintered bronze. Powdered metal offer both strength and flexibility. Additionally, they offer a cost effective production process that includes oil impregnation or permanent lubrication.
